Figure 5 in Revision of the hirsuticornis-like species of Macrothrix Baird, 1843 (Cladocera: Anomopoda: Macrothricidae) from Subantarctic and temperate regions of the southern hemisphere
Figure 5. Macrothric boergeni, thoracic appendages of adult parthenogenetic female from an unnamed pond near Port-aux-Français, Îles Kerguelen. (A–C) Limb II, its distal portion and gnathobase; (D, E) limb III and its inner portion; (F, G) limb IV and its inner portion; (H) seta 1 of inner portion of limb IV; (I) limb V; (J) its inner portion of other individual. Scale bars: 0.1 mm.
Figure 3 in Revision of the hirsuticornis-like species of Macrothrix Baird, 1843 (Cladocera: Anomopoda: Macrothricidae) from Subantarctic and temperate regions of the southern hemisphere
Figure 3. Macrothric boergeni, adult parthenogenetic female from an unnamed pond near Port-aux-Français, Îles Kerguelen. (A, B) Postabdominal claw; (C) antennae I; (D) antenna II; (E) its basal segment and basal portion of branches; (F) setae of antenna II; (G) limb I, inner view; (H) its distal portion; (I) distal portion of limb II. Scale bars: 0.1 (C–E, G); 0.01 mm (A, B, F, H, I).
Figure 1 in Revision of the hirsuticornis-like species of Macrothrix Baird, 1843 (Cladocera: Anomopoda: Macrothricidae) from Subantarctic and temperate regions of the southern hemisphere
Figure 1. Macrothric boergeni, parthenogenetic female from an unnamed pond near Port-aux-Français, Îles Kerguelen. (A) Large adult; (B, C) head; (D) setae in anterior portion of valve ventral margin; (E) middle of ventral margin; (F, G) posterior portion of ventral margin; (H) postabdomen; (I, J) postabdominal claw, outer view; (K) postabdominal claw, inner view; (L, M) antenna I in lateral and anterior view; (N) its distal end; (O) aesthetascs; (P) juvenile. Scale bars: 0.1 mm.
Figure 2 in Revision of the hirsuticornis-like species of Macrothrix Baird, 1843 (Cladocera: Anomopoda: Macrothricidae) from Subantarctic and temperate regions of the southern hemisphere
Figure 2. Macrothric boergeni, adult parthenogenetic female from an unnamed pond near Port-aux-Français, Îles Kerguelen. (A) Lateral view; (B) latero-ventral view; (C) anterior view; (D) setae at ventral margin of valve; (E) dorsal head pore; (F) mandibular articulation; (G, H) postabdomen, lateral and dorsal view. Scale bars: 0.1 mm (A–D, G, H); 0.01 (E, F).

Allen Brain Atlas
Allen Brain Atlas is an Allen Institute collection of brain map atlases, datasets, APIs, and analysis tools covering mouse, human, and non-human primate brain resources.
Annotated Behaviour and Observability Dataset (ABODe)
ABODe is a University of Edinburgh DataShare dataset for behavior classification in group-housed mice using home-cage video, identities, bounding boxes, ground-plate positions, and annotator labels.
DANDI Archive for NWB datasets
DANDI is a BRAIN Initiative archive for publishing and sharing neurophysiology data, including electrophysiology, optophysiology, and behavioral data packaged as NWB and related standards.
International Brain Laboratory public data
The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.
OpenNeuro
OpenNeuro is a free, open platform for sharing neuroimaging datasets, with public search, dataset pages, and download paths for web, S3, DataLad, and the OpenNeuro CLI.
